    Date of Travel: 26 July 2020
    Class of Travel: Comfort Class (Couchette)
    Rolling Stock: E.464/Various
    Cost of Ticket: €74.90 (£65.40, $90.90)
    Origin: Palermo Centrale, Sicily, Italy
    Destination: Roma Termini, Rome, Italy

    I took the other intercity notte departing at 10pm from Palermo back in late September last year. I was on the deluxe sleeper which was actually freezing cold due to AC that couldn’t be turnt off;) They provided a newspaper along with a breakfast in the morning. However the car was incredibly loud, you could barely sleep. The scenery around Naples was amazing indeed. The sleeper car felt much older than these couchettes but it was comfy. Overall a very positive experience.

    A few years ago i was inter-railing trough Sicilia in May, i took the Eurocity from Munich to Verona, than the Freccia Rossa to Napels and from there the Freccia Bianca to San Giovanni.
    In May there are no trains on the Ferry so i was just a walking passenger on the Ferry to Messina.
    I did not took the nighttrain but traveld only during daytime, i loved Sicilia, a beautifull island, i flew back from Catania to Dusseldorf
